## Further reading

The Cindervault bloom filter sits in front of the key-value store to absorb negative lookups. False-positive rate is tuned to 0.5%; there are no false negatives. Note the filter is rebuilt nightly and is not access-controlled separately from the store itself. Threat model notes, rebuild procedure, and sizing math are collected on the internal design page.

dashboard of tahop-fahof = https://harbor.tolvaqnet.example/secrets/merge_requests/board/issue/merge_requests/pipeline/secrets/ecb30ed86a55c001a77f6cb9

## Cold Storage Archiving — Limits & Quotas

Glacierbox buckets older than 180 days are archived by the Frostline batch job. Quotas are per-tenant: exceeding them pauses archiving until the next cycle, no alerts fired. Don't raise limits without approval from the Storage Guild. The current tuning constants are listed below.

constants for bawif-kawif:
QUOTAS = {
    "ulaael": 5,
    "holael": 10,
}

### Ticket: Config drift in Marginalia render pipeline

So the markdown pipeline on the Quornfield boxes has drifted again — staging is sanitizing embedded HTML but prod apparently isn't, which is how that table-rendering bug slipped through last week. Someone hand-edited prod back in the spring and it never made it into the repo. I'd like a reviewer to eyeball the diff before I force-sync everything from source control. For reference, here's what prod is actually running with right now.

service settings:
[briius]
port = 3000
region = outer-1
host = briius.zarqeldyn.internal
team = wenael
timeout_ms = 2000
retries = 5

## Local Setup — PickPath Optimizer

Clone the repo, run `make bootstrap`, and you're mostly there. PickPath needs the solver sidecar running locally, so start that first or the optimizer will just spin. Seed data for the Bramfield warehouse layout ships with the repo — load it with `make seed`.

To point your local instance at the shared dev database, use the connection string below.

replica DSN, yahog-kawig: redis://istox_svc:um@db-8a67.halixforge.test:5432/frawyn